融合样式
融合样式是一种面向桌面的样式。
融合样式是一种与平台无关的样式,它提供了面向桌面的外观和感觉。它实现了与Qt Widgets 融合样式相同的设计语言。
融合样式的浅色主题。 | 融合样式的深色主题。 |
要在应用中使用融合样式,请参阅在 Qt Quick 控件中使用样式。
注意:融合样式不是一个原生桌面样式。该样式在各种平台上运行,外观相似。由于系统调色板、可用的字体和字体渲染引擎的不同,可能会出现一些细微的差异。
自定义
融合样式使用标准的系统调色板来提供与桌面环境匹配的颜色。
可以为任何控件、弹出或应用程序窗口指定自定义调色板。显式调色板属性会自动从父元素传播到子元素,并覆盖该属性的系统默认值。在以下示例中,窗口和所有三个开关都显示为紫色高亮颜色
import QtQuick 2.12 import QtQuick.Controls 2.12 ApplicationWindow { visible: true palette.highlight: "violet" Column { anchors.centerIn: parent Switch { text: qsTr("First"); checked: true } Switch { text: qsTr("Second"); checked: true } Switch { text: qsTr("Third") } } } |
相关信息
© 2024 The Qt Company Ltd. 所含文档的贡献均是相应所有者的版权。所提供的文档根据自由软件基金会发布的GNU 自由文档许可证版本 1.3的条款提供。Qt 和相应的标志是芬兰的 The Qt Company Ltd. 及其在世界其他国家的商标。所有其他商标均为其相应所有者的财产。